Voices of Faith: Finding a true calling in service to the Lord 07.03.2025

Deacon Ryan Sales has always felt a call to serve; and he has found many ways to do it—as a member of the Canadian Air Force, a paramedic, a homicide detective. But it wasn’t until he became deacon that his call to service gained focus: as a call to serve God and His Church. Dave Palmer, executive director of the north Texas office of the Guadalupe Radio Network, has been a prominent voice in Catholic radio for almost two decades. In this episode of Voices of Faith , Palmer shares the story of how he became a Catholic communicator in north Texas and learned to bring together his love of broadcasting and the faith.
